## Barcode Scanner Integration

The Scanwell module handles all barcode input for the Lunabox fulfillment suite. Release builds must bundle the scanner firmware manifest, which the Kettleworth team updates roughly every sprint. Before cutting a release, verify that the manifest version matches the one pinned in the release checklist, and confirm the UPC and Code-128 regression suites pass on the staging rig in the Marlow lab. Full integration steps, rollback notes, and the firmware compatibility matrix are on the internal page here:

wiki page, fahif-bawep: https://jira.tolvaqsys.internal/browse/projects/projects/67caf315

Subject: Quickstore 4.2 — bloom filter now fronts the KV layer

Plugin authors: starting with this release, Quickstore places a bloom filter ahead of the key-value store. Negative lookups return faster; false positives fall through safely. No API changes are required on your side. Verify your plugin against the staging build referenced below.

session token of fahif-tadup = htk3_9c7

## Configuration

Hey release crew — LinkWeave's deep-link router reads everything from `.env.release`. Set LINKWEAVE_SCHEME to the app scheme and LINKWEAVE_FALLBACK_URL for uninstalled users. Don't forget LINKWEAVE_ENV=prod before cutting a build, or links route to staging. The attribution service also needs its credential, so the next line in the file sets that.

vault entry, kafog-yahop: COURIER_KEY8=0faa53ae

**Build Provenance: Murkwell log sampler**

The Murkwell ingest service emits ~40k lines/min; release builds ship with sampling at 1:50 for INFO and 1:1 for WARN+. Provenance attestations cover the sampler config hash, so any rate change requires a re-sign before promotion. Verify the signed manifest matches the staging artifact, then record the provenance token appearing below.

pipeline stamp: htk3_cc5